Troubleshooting
Table 2–2
Primary Beep Codes
Beep Code
Possible
Problem
Corrective Action
Two short
beeps
Keyboard
failure
Be sure the keyboard cable is firmly
connected.
Hard disk
failure
Be sure the drive cables are firmly
connected and all drive and adapter
jumpers are set correctly.
Diskette drive
failure
Be sure drive cables are firmly
connected and the drive switch is set
correctly.
Tape drive
failure
Be sure the drive cables are firmly
connected and all drive and host
adapter jumpers are set correctly.
Invalid
configuration
Check the information entered with
the Setup utility.
Configuration
record bad
Check the information entered with
the Setup utility. See the hard disk
installation guide for configuration
information. Check the CMOS
battery connection.
Clock chip
lost power
Turn the computer off, wait 20
seconds and then turn it on again.
Check the CMOS battery connection.
Long-short-
long-short
beep
Video failure
Be sure the VGA jumper setting is
enabled on the main logic board.
Several
bursts of
beeps
1
BIOS ROM,
CMOS,
DMA, RAM,
interrupt, or
read/write
errors
Check cable connections and jumper
and switch settings. If the problem
persists, there might be a problem
on the main logic board.
1
If the system generates bursts of beeps, refer to Table 2–3 for a list of specific
failure locations corresponding to the particular numeric beep code pattern.
